Lace Cookies with Chocolate (Florentine Cookies)

These Chocolate Florentine Lace Cookies are so decadent. You'll love the mix of nutty, chocolaty, & sweet in these perfect holiday cookies.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 8 minutes
Total Time 38 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ine American
Servings 24 chocolate sandwiched cookies
Calories 200 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1 cup 100g whole almonds (or 1 cup almond flour)
  • ¼ cup 30g all-purpose flour
  • ½ cup 115g unsalted butter
  • ½ cup 100g golden brown sugar
  • ¼ cup 60ml honey
  • ½ tsp vanilla extract
  • ¾ cup 130g semi-sweet chocolate chips

Instructions
 

Prepare Almonds

  • I pulse 1 cup whole almonds in a food processor until finely ground into almond flour, setting aside for these Crispy Nutty Treats.

Melt Butter and Sugar

  • In a medium saucepan, I melt ½ cup butter, ½ cup brown sugar, and ¼ cup honey over medium heat, stirring with a whisk until it reaches a gentle boil, then remove from heat.

Add Flour and Vanilla

  • I stir in ¼ cup flour and ½ tsp vanilla extract until smooth, ensuring no lumps for Lace Cookies with Chocolate.

Mix in Almonds

  • Using a spatula, I fold in the ground almonds until fully combined, creating a cohesive batter.

Shape Dough

  • I preheat the oven to 325°F (165°C). I scoop ½-tbsp portions of dough onto a baking sheet lined with a silicone mat or parchment paper, spacing them 3 inches apart. I roll each scoop into a ball and place it back on the sheet.

Bake Cookies

  • I bake for 8 minutes, rotating the sheet halfway at 4 minutes, until the cookies spread thin and turn golden. I let them cool on the sheet for 5 minutes, then transfer to a rack.

Melt Chocolate and Assemble

  • In a microwave-safe bowl, I melt ¾ cup chocolate chips in 15-second bursts, stirring to prevent scorching. I spread a thin layer of chocolate on the bottom of one cookie and sandwich with another, repeating for all Lace Cookies with Chocolate. I let them set for 1–2 hours.

Notes

  • Use almond flour- Almond flour or fresh-ground almonds are responsible for not just the delicious flavor, but also the texture of these lace cookies. If you replace almond flour with all-purpose, these cookies will not spread to become thin and crispy, so stick with the almonds.
  • Trim the edges of your cookies- If your cookies come out a little irregular, you can trim them with scissors into circles, so they sandwich together just right.
  • Keep an eye on your melted chocolate- When microwaving chocolate, stop it every 15-30 seconds to give it a stir. This keeps the chocolate from scorching and not being heated a moment more than necessary.
